Specification of Incorrect Fillet Weld Size Requirements for Branch Connections 1.

Introduction Southwest Fabricating and Welding Co., Inc. (SkT) was contacted in February, 1980, by South Carolina Electric and Gas Company and Gilbert Associates Inc. personnel to ascertain the basis and justi-fication for the specification by SkT on Virgil C. Summer Unit 1 shop drawings of 1/4 inch leg length reinforcement fillet welds for branch connections.

The specific area of concern related to interpretation of the applicable fillet weld size requirements for branch connections, contained in paragraph NC-3643 of the ASME Code (through the 1973 Summer Addendum).

i Figure NC-3643.2(a)-1, which is identified by NC-3643 as depicting acceptable methods of joining a coupling to a run pipe for branch connections not requiring reinforcement, included a reference to fillet weld throat size (t ) for the type of joint design, i.e.

C full penetration weld with fillet weld reinforcement, utilized by SkT for branch connections on this contract.

Requirements for t were not, however, specified in this Figure. In an attempt to inEer prete applicable ASME requirements for this t dimension, an assump-tion was made by the Architect Engineer /UtiliEy that the branch connection weld could be classified as an ASME Code Category D weld joint (nozzle to main shell weld).

With this classification the tc dimension would be required to be not less than the smaller of 1/4 inch or 70% of the coupling thickness at the branch pipe region.

Specification of a 1/4 inch minimum leg length fillet weld will produce a minimum equivalent throat dimension of 0.176 inches.

This dimension was established to exceed 70% of coupling thickness for all branch connections, with the exception of those used to attach

3 1

inch and 2 inch schedule 160 branch piping. Review by SWF identified three (3) shop drawings, Sales Order (S.O.) Q4165-B, Sheet hos. 7, 12 and 15, which contained couplings attached by full penetration welds with 1/4 inch minimum leg length reinforcement fillet welds and to which 2 inch schedule 160 branch piping would be connected in the field.

4.

Findings Within the area of this inspection, no deviations from commit-a.

ment or unresolved items were identified.

b.

After review of applicable ASME Code requirements, the inspector was unable to determine any basis for applying the ASME Code Category D fillet weld size requirements on the subject branch connections, in that:

(1) The size and type of couplings and method of attachment

4 satisfied the specific provisions of NC-3643 for branch connections not requiring reinforcement.

i (2) The 1974 Edition of the ASME Code clarified this matter by elimination of any reference to a t fillet weld throat dimension on the applicable Figure.

(3) The ASME Code weld joint classification categories do not appear to be applicable to piping fabrication, in that the definitions are written solely in terms of vessel fabrication.

c.

No contractual requirements were identified in the customer specification with respect to fillet weld sizes for Class 2 branch connections up to two (2) inch pipe size.

C.

Exit Meeting The inspector met with the management representatives denoted in paragraph A. above on February 29, 1980, at the conclusion of the inspection.

The inspector informed management that the special inspection was performed as a result of information provided to Region IV by Region II of the Office of Inspection and Enforcement, relative to identified errors on SWF drawings concerning fillet weld size requirements for piping branch connections. The inspector summarized the scope of the inspection and informed management that no deviations from commitment or unresolved items had been identified.
